Right now my problem is that I can't seem to share a folder so that I
can see it from my Windows computer.  Right now I want to start copying
files over to Ubuntu machine from Windows so that I can start working in
the Ubuntu platform with these files.  It is so simply in Windows to
share a folder but I can't get it to work with Ubuntu.  I have the
Ubuntu Unleashed book and have followed those instructions but I can't
get it to work.  I have shared the folder within Ubuntu.  The Ubuntu
machine shows up in Windows but it asks me to log in with user name and
password but it does not accept the user name and password that Ubuntu
is set up with.

 

Can someone give me an explanation of how to get Ubuntu to share a
folder with Windows?

 

PS  Both machines are on the same network and DHCP server.  I assume
that they are both getting IP addresses from the DHCP server.  How do I
check what IP address the Ubuntu machine has?
